WebJun 13, 2024 · Normally, bits are combined in the processor in order to use and store data more efficiently, since it is rare for any program to contain only a single bit. Most modern PCs combine the bits in groups of 32 or 64, unsurprisingly called 32-bit or 64-bit computers. For faster operation with big programs, a 64-bit structure is more efficient.

All in all, binary code enables us to communicate with computers and give them instructions. WebEven Parity Code. The value of even parity bit should be zero, if even number of ones present in the binary code. Otherwise, it should be one. So that, even number of ones present in even parity code. Even parity code contains the data bits and even parity bit. The following table shows the even parity codes corresponding to each 3-bit binary ... fittings door furniture
